On Mon, 2004-02-09 at 20:31, Tom Lord wrote:
> I should have said "rate and timing of change". The truly paranoid
> can at least obscure both just by mixing in a large number of
> statistically plausible junk commits.
You can always do that of course (actually, you may both want to and not
want to based on the archive format I'm making up)
Plus, it just occurred to me -- each changeset could be tacked on with
some random garbage, since afaik tla doesn't read stuff in the changeset
that isn't related to the usual file layout in there.
So, additionally to having mod-dirs-index etc in the changeset tar, you
could put a file ",,resizing-junk" in there as well to hide the size of
your changesets.
